Plant Extracts for Beautiful Skin: A Guide
Achieving clear skin doesn’t necessitate a complex skincare regimen . Several individuals are embracing the power of essential oils as a gentle solution. These aromatic oils, obtained from plants, offer a wealth of perks for your complexion. Here's a quick look at some top options.
- Lavender Essence: Known for its relaxing properties, it can reduce redness .
- Tea Tree Extract : A remarkable antiseptic, ideal for treating blemishes.
- Rosehip Seed Oil : Rich in nutrients , it supports cell turnover .
- Frankincense Resin: Can lessen the look of marks .
Please note to carefully mix essential oils with a copyright oil like sweet almond oil before using to your skin, and conduct a skin test first to check for potential issues. Talking to a experienced skincare professional is also recommended for tailored advice.
